タグ

pythonとluaに関するginmatsuのブックマーク (2)

  • Android上でスクリプティング環境を実現する「ASE」 - @IT

    2009/06/09 グーグルは6月8日、モバイル向けプラットフォームのAndroid上でPythonやLuaを使ったスクリプティング環境を提供するオープンソースのプロジェクトAndroid Scripting Environment」(ASE)の存在を明らかにした。端末の画面側を下にして置いた場合に呼び出し音を抑制する、といった簡単なアプリケーションを20行ほどのスクリプトで実現できるという。スクリプトはPC上の開発環境ではなく、デバイス上で直接入力して実行することができる。Pythonでは、インタラクティブな実行モードもサポートする。 これまでにもAndroid上でPythonRubyといった処理系を動かす実験的な取り組みはあったが、ASEはAndroid上の標準的なパッケージとして提供する点が異なる。BeanShellはDalvik VM上で直接動くため、Javaでアプリケーショ

    ginmatsu
    ginmatsu 2009/07/02
    端末自体でコーディングできるのは大きい。Pythonはインタラクティブ(対話的)な実行モードもサポート。
  • AndroidアプリをPython・Ruby・JavaScriptで開発する | エンタープライズ | マイコミジャーナル

    Android Scripting Enviornment brings scripting languages to Android 最新版のiPhoneとなるiPhone 3G Sが発表された。さまざまな改善がほどこされているが、最大のポイントはアプリケーションが以前よりも高速に軽快に動作するようになったことだ。iPhoneの特徴は電話というよりもアプリケーションとサービスにある。実行速度の高速化は多くのユーザや開発者が望んでいたことだけに、この新製品は従来製品からの乗り換え組みを多いに満足させることになりそうだ。 iPhoneのネイティブアプリケーション開発はそれほど難しいものではないが、大きくみて2つの障壁がある。ひとつは開発環境がMac OS Xの特定のバージョン以降とアーキテクチャ向けにしか提供されていないこと、もうひとつは開発言語がObjective-Cであることだ。Obje

    ginmatsu
    ginmatsu 2009/07/02
    Androidがスプリクト言語(Python・Lua、将来的にはRuby・JavaScript)をサポートすることを初めて知った。iPhoneはスクリプト言語をサポートしてない。
  • 1